Cleopas
Holman Bible Dictionary
(clee' oh puhss) A follower of Jesus, who with a companion was traveling toward the village of Emmaus on the day of Christ's resurrection (Luke 24:13-25 ). They were joined by a person whom they did not recognize. Later, they discovered that the stranger was Jesus Himself.
